When Will I-95 Reopen?

This is the million-dollar question, right? When will I-95 near St. Augustine, FL reopen after this accident? Unfortunately, there's no definitive timeline yet. The duration of highway closures after major accidents like this depends on several factors. First, investigators need to complete their on-scene assessment, which involves documenting evidence, interviewing witnesses, and determining the cause. Then, the debris needs to be cleared, which can be a massive undertaking depending on the severity of the damage and the number of vehicles involved. Finally, the road surface itself needs to be inspected to ensure it's safe for travel. We're talking about potentially hours of work. Officials are working as quickly and safely as possible to get traffic moving again, but they won't rush the process at the expense of thorough investigation and safety. Safety Reminders for Drivers

Given the chaos caused by this accident on I-95 today near St. Augustine, FL, it's a good time for a friendly reminder about road safety, guys. Accidents happen, but many can be prevented. Always practice safe driving habits: stay focused on the road, avoid distractions like your phone, and obey speed limits. Fatigue is also a major factor in accidents, so if you're feeling tired, pull over and take a break. Most importantly, maintain a safe following distance from the vehicle in front of you. That little bit of extra space can make all the difference in preventing a rear-end collision, which are unfortunately common. When you see emergency vehicles with flashing lights, always move over if you can safely do so. This is not only the law in Florida but a crucial step in protecting our brave first responders.
